Pull request-automatisering
pull request-automatisering
Topp 12 AI-kodeløsningsagenter for ingeniørhastighet og kvalitet
Språk/rammeverk: Copilot er språkagnostisk (all kode i repoet er aktuell), selv om det fungerer best for populære språk (JavaScript, TypeScript,...
Pull request-automatisering
Pull request-automatisering handler om å bruke verktøy og skript for å gjøre håndteringen av innsendte endringer mer effektiv. Når en utvikler foreslår endringer, kan automatisering sørge for at tester kjøres, bygg verifieres, avhengigheter oppdateres og at nødvendige kontrollsjekker utføres før videre behandling. Automatiske meldinger kan også tilordne rett reviewer, legge til kommentarer, oppdatere beskrivelse og legge inn nødvendige merknader. På den måten reduseres manuelt arbeid og responstiden blir kortere, noe som fremskynder godkjenningsprosessen. Systemet kan også automatisk slå sammen endringer når alle krav er oppfylt, eller blokkere merge hvis feil oppstår. Automatisering gir større konsistens og sporbarhet i hvordan endringer behandles og dokumenteres. Likevel må regler og tillatelser settes opp med omhu for å unngå utilsiktede merginger eller sikkerhetsproblemer. Menneskelig vurdering for komplekse eller arkitektoniske endringer forblir viktig. Riktig brukt gir pull request-automatisering et mer forutsigbart og effektivt arbeidsflyt for programvareutvikling.